ISLAMABAD TONIGHT
WITH NADEEM MALIK
02-02-2012
TOPIC- CONTEMPT OF COURT CASE AGAINST PM
GUESTS- SM ZAFAR, YASEEN AZAD, AZAM SAWATI, AHMED RAZA QASOORI
SM ZAFAR A LAWYER said that the prime minister sacrificed himself untimely and needlessly. He said that Supreme Court decision is absolutely correct and court gave sufficient time to PM to abide. He said that PM sacrifice is untimely because important decisions are suppose to be taken on Afghanistan at this moment. He said that PM should write the letter to Swiss court and ask for pardon to SC otherwise charges will be labeled.
YASEEN AZAD PSCBA said that in his opinion it will be difficult for the PM to write the letter to Swiss court at this moment. He said that it is difficult time for the Prime Minister. He said that it will be better for the PM to write the letter to Swiss court.
AZAM SAWATI OF PTI said that the plundering has been proven and the national wealth is looted but the PM is reluctant to write the letter to Swiss court. He said that the people have lost confidence on institutions. He said that the corruption is rampant and people are dying. He said that the NRO was signed to protect the culprits. He said that two billion rupees are missing from the compensation money of Bhasha dam.
AHMED RAZA QASOORI OF AML said that the government used delaying tactics at every step of the case. He said that the court is showing constraint on its decisions otherwise situation can deteriorate. He said that the people have faith in the judiciary and it is a huge test of the judiciary. He said that it is true that judiciary is unable to implement its decisions. He said that if the PM contest the case and lose it he will not be the PM any more. He said that we should accept the decisions of the courts and should not give them different names.
